Yogurtland Donates Sales to spcaLA
Los Angeles, CA – Yogurtland (Miracle Mile) is celebrating their one-year anniversary on September 19th by donating their net sales for the day to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als Los Angeles (spcaLA). That’s right, 100% of their net sales on September 19th will be donated to spcaLA!
Kyoung Park, owner of the Miracle Mile Yogurtland franchise says, "During these hard times, we need to help others including our four legged friends. We know that businesses are struggling to stay open. We are blessed to have a business that is doing well, so we would like to share our blessings with spcaLA." Yogurtland serves 16 flavors and 32 toppings to cater to your yogurt desires. Free Yogurtland t-shirts will be given to customers for supporting spcaLA with a minimum purchase of $5.00 (while supplies last).A temperatures rise this weekend, cool down with some refreshing yogurt while supporting spcaLA’s furry friends.
